Emerging Trends and Industry Shift Toward Personalized Matching
The dating industry has traditionally been dominated by swipe-based apps like Tinder and Bumble, which prioritize quick, superficial interactions. Over recent years, there has been growing criticism of these platforms for fostering shallow connections and contributing to dating fatigue. Meanwhile, the rise of matchmakers, coaching services, and AI-driven algorithms has introduced more tailored approaches. Notably, startups such as The League and Hinge have incorporated features emphasizing compatibility and shared values. This trend toward relationship curation aligns with broader societal shifts emphasizing authenticity, long-term planning, and emotional well-being in romantic relationships.
Industry insiders note that the concept of curated dating is not entirely new but is gaining renewed attention as consumers seek more meaningful interactions in a digital age. The push for personalized matching is also supported by research indicating that people increasingly desire serious, committed relationships rather than casual encounters.

Unclear Adoption Rates and Industry Impact
It is not yet clear how quickly relationship curation will be adopted at scale or whether it will significantly disrupt traditional dating platforms. While some startups report positive early results, broader industry acceptance remains uncertain, and consumer preferences may vary. Additionally, long-term data on the effectiveness of curated matching in fostering durable relationships is still emerging.

Key Questions
What is relationship curation?
Relationship curation is a personalized approach to dating that emphasizes tailored matching based on compatibility, values, and long-term potential, often using in-depth assessments and expert guidance.
How does it differ from traditional dating apps?
Unlike swipe-based apps that focus on superficial features and quick judgments, curated platforms prioritize meaningful connections through personalized, compatibility-based matching.
Is relationship curation effective for long-term relationships?
Early reports and expert opinions suggest it can improve the quality and durability of relationships, though comprehensive long-term studies are still underway.
Will this approach replace traditional dating apps?
It is uncertain; current trends indicate that curated dating may complement rather than replace existing platforms, especially as consumers seek more serious connections.
What are the challenges facing relationship curation?
Challenges include scaling personalized assessments, ensuring user trust, and convincing a broad audience to shift from familiar swipe-based platforms.
